Understanding Fire Doors: Types, Features, and Functions

Fire doors are an essential component of any building's fire safety strategy. They are specifically designed to prevent the spread of fire and smoke, providing crucial time for occupants to evacuate safely and for emergency services to respond. Understanding what a fire door is, how it works, and why it is important can help ensure that buildings are adequately protected against fire hazards.

At its core, a fire door is a door with a fire-resistance rating, meaning it has been tested to withstand fire for a certain period, typically ranging from 20 minutes to 3 hours. These doors are constructed using materials that can resist high temperatures and are often equipped with intumescent seals that expand when exposed to heat, effectively sealing off gaps that could allow smoke and flames to pass through.

Fire doors are not just ordinary doors; they are engineered to meet strict safety standards. They are typically made from a combination of materials such as steel, timber, or glass, each chosen for its ability to withstand fire. The door's core is often filled with fire-resistant materials like gypsum or vermiculite, which enhance its ability to resist heat and flames. Additionally, fire doors are fitted with specialized hardware, including fire-rated hinges, locks, and closers, to ensure they function correctly during a fire.

One of the key features of a fire door is its ability to compartmentalize a building. In the event of a fire, these doors create barriers that contain the fire to a specific area, preventing it from spreading rapidly throughout the building. This compartmentation is crucial in large buildings, such as offices, hospitals, and schools, where the spread of fire could have devastating consequences. By containing the fire, fire doors help to minimize damage and provide safe escape routes for occupants.

Another important aspect of fire doors is their role in protecting escape routes. In many buildings, fire doors are installed in stairwells, corridors, and other critical areas that serve as escape paths during an emergency. These doors are designed to remain closed or to close automatically in the event of a fire, ensuring that smoke and flames do not block these vital routes. This is particularly important in high-rise buildings, where the time it takes to evacuate can be significantly longer.

It's important to note that fire doors must be properly maintained to ensure they function as intended. Regular inspections and maintenance are essential to identify and address any issues, such as damaged seals, faulty hardware, or improper installation. Building owners and managers have a legal responsibility to ensure that fire doors are in good working condition and comply with relevant fire safety regulations.

In addition to their primary function of fire containment, fire doors also play a role in reducing the spread of toxic smoke. Smoke inhalation is one of the leading causes of fire-related deaths, and fire doors help to limit the movement of smoke through a building. This not only protects occupants but also reduces the risk of secondary fires caused by smoke spreading to other areas.

Fire doors are also subject to rigorous testing and certification processes. Before a fire door can be installed, it must undergo testing by accredited laboratories to ensure it meets the required fire-resistance standards. These tests simulate real fire conditions to assess the door's ability to withstand heat, flames, and smoke. Once a door has passed these tests, it is certified and labeled accordingly, providing assurance that it meets the necessary safety standards.
